Cyber Security Networking Basics

Welcome to The Coding College, your trusted destination for tech and coding knowledge. In this article, we’ll explore the networking basics essential for cyber security, breaking down the core concepts that help protect networks and secure data in today’s interconnected world.

Why is Networking Important in Cyber Security?

Networking forms the backbone of digital communication. Understanding how networks function is crucial for identifying vulnerabilities, mitigating risks, and building robust defenses against cyber threats.

Whether you’re managing a corporate network or safeguarding your home devices, networking knowledge is a fundamental part of cyber security.

Key Networking Concepts for Cyber Security

1. OSI Model

The Open Systems Interconnection (OSI) Model is a conceptual framework that describes how data flows through a network. It consists of 7 layers:

  • Physical: Hardware like cables and switches.
  • Data Link: Manages data transfer between devices.
  • Network: Routing data using IP addresses.
  • Transport: Ensures reliable data delivery.
  • Session: Establishes and terminates connections.
  • Presentation: Formats data for application use.
  • Application: Interfaces with software applications (e.g., browsers).

Understanding these layers helps pinpoint where cyber threats, such as sniffing or spoofing, might occur.

2. IP Addresses and Subnetting

  • IP Addresses: Unique identifiers for devices on a network (e.g., IPv4 and IPv6).
  • Subnetting: Dividing a network into smaller segments to enhance security and performance.

3. MAC Addresses

Media Access Control (MAC) addresses uniquely identify devices at the hardware level, crucial for managing and securing network access.

4. Firewalls

Firewalls act as a barrier between trusted and untrusted networks, filtering incoming and outgoing traffic based on predefined rules.

5. VPNs (Virtual Private Networks)

VPNs encrypt your internet connection, providing a secure channel for data transmission. They’re a critical tool for remote work and protecting sensitive information.

Common Network Security Threats

Understanding networking basics helps you identify and mitigate threats such as:

  1. Man-in-the-Middle (MITM) Attacks
    Cybercriminals intercept communications between two parties to steal sensitive information.
  2. DDoS Attacks
    Overloading a server or network with excessive traffic, disrupting services.
  3. Packet Sniffing
    Monitoring data packets traveling across a network to capture sensitive information.
  4. Spoofing
    Impersonating devices or users to gain unauthorized access.

Tools for Networking and Cyber Security

To enhance network security, professionals use tools such as:

  • Wireshark: A powerful tool for network analysis and packet inspection.
  • Nmap: Used for network discovery and security auditing.
  • Cisco Packet Tracer: A simulation tool for understanding network configurations.
  • Kali Linux: A platform offering numerous tools for penetration testing and security analysis.

Networking Best Practices for Cyber Security

  1. Enable Encryption
    Encrypt sensitive communications using protocols like HTTPS, TLS, and SSH.
  2. Implement Access Controls
    Use VLANs (Virtual Local Area Networks) and segment networks to limit unauthorized access.
  3. Regular Updates
    Ensure routers, firewalls, and other devices are updated to protect against known vulnerabilities.
  4. Monitor Network Traffic
    Deploy intrusion detection systems (IDS) and intrusion prevention systems (IPS) to monitor and block suspicious activity.
  5. Educate Users
    Train employees and users on recognizing phishing attempts and other cyber threats.

Careers in Networking and Cyber Security

If you’re passionate about networking and cyber security, consider roles like:

  • Network Security Engineer: Focuses on protecting networks from breaches.
  • Cyber Security Analyst: Monitors and responds to security incidents.
  • Penetration Tester: Simulates attacks to identify network vulnerabilities.

At The Coding College, we offer tutorials and resources to help you start or advance your career in these fields.

Why Learn Networking Basics at The Coding College?

Understanding networking is a cornerstone of cyber security. At The Coding College, we provide clear, expert-guided content that makes mastering these concepts simple and practical.

Visit The Coding College for more tutorials, guides, and insights into networking, cyber security, and beyond.

Final Thoughts

Mastering networking basics is the first step toward becoming proficient in cyber security. By learning these foundational concepts, you’ll be better equipped to identify threats, secure networks, and protect sensitive information.

Stay connected with The Coding College for more tutorials, tips, and resources to help you thrive in the tech world.

Learn. Secure. Excel.

Leave a Comment